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Three Rivers to Detroit is to drive which costs $27 - $40 and takes 2h 54m.
The fastest way to get from Three Rivers to Detroit is to drive which takes 2h 54m and costs $27 - $40.
The distance between Three Rivers and Detroit is 166 miles. The road distance is 149.7 miles.
The best way to get from Three Rivers to Detroit without a car is to taxi and bus which takes 3h 24m and costs $110 - $150.
It takes approximately 3h 24m to get from Three Rivers to Detroit,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Three Rivers to Detroit is 150 miles. It takes approximately 2h 54m to drive from Three Rivers to Detroit.
